During the final challenge, the three finalists Jennifer Barney, Joshua Livsey, and Stephany Buswell were to make a holiday dessert inspired by any line from Twelve Days of Christmas. Barney stole the day with her favorite cake recipe gingerbread cake decorated with eggnog buttercream to delict six geese a-laying in the Christmas tune. "The shows aren't cumulative unless specifically stated," Goldman told Insider. Duff Goldman, pastry chef, author of "Super Good Baking for Kids," and longtime judge on Food Network's "Holiday Baking Championship" and "Kids Baking Championship," told Insider that individual challenges count the most for judges. Although it varies by show, Goldman said, some series particularly those featuring baking allow contestants to bring written recipes they can refer to during the competition.
